Identification

Chemical structure
Display Name:
Silicic acid, sodium salt
EC Number:
215-687-4
EC Name:
Silicic acid, sodium salt
CAS Number:
1344-09-8
Molecular formula:
Na2O x (SiO2)n with Molar Ratio (MR) (SiO2/Na2O): 1.5 – 4
IUPAC Name:
sodium hydroxy(oxo)silanolate

Type of Substance

Composition:
UVCB
Origin:
inorganic
